Taobao Shipping Canada Customs
When using Taobao's official forwarding service, taxes and duties must be paid by the customer. Here's an overview of Canadian customs rules:
- Threshold: Duties and taxes are calculated based on the declared value (product cost + shipping + insurance).
- Duty-Free Limit: Packages under CAD 20 (approx. ¥10 RMB) are usually duty-free.
- Above CAD 20: May be subject to import duties and taxes.
- GST/HST: Goods imported into Canada are subject to federal GST or provincial HST, typically 5%-15%, depending on the province.
-
Duties: Vary by product type. For example:
- Clothing, shoes: duties can reach 18% or more.
- Electronics (phones, computers): usually 0% duty but subject to GST/HST.
- Handling Fees: If tax is prepaid by Canada Post or a courier, a handling fee may apply (e.g., Canada Post charges CAD 9.95).
Tip:
If a parcel is not inspected, duties are typically waived. If inspected and value exceeds CAD 20, duties and taxes may apply.

Is shipping from Taobao to Canada free? +
Usually not. The previous "¥299 Free Shipping to Canada" promotion has ended. That campaign offered free air shipping on select items once the cart total reached ¥299 RMB, but only on items marked with the green free-shipping tag, such as jewelry, bags, glasses, and organizers.
Can Taobao ship to Canada? +
Yes. There are two main options: use Taobao's official logistics (choose "Direct Mail" or "Forwarding" when checking out), or use a third-party forwarder—just enter the forwarder's warehouse address when ordering and consolidate later.
How long does Taobao shipping to Canada take? +
Taobao official shipping:
- Air: Promised time is 5 business days, but delays can occur due to peak seasons or customs, ranging from 1-7 days of wait time before flight.
- Sea: 15+ days.
Private forwarding (e.g. JYS):
- Air: Typically 5–10 days.
- Sea: As fast as 15 days.
Is Cainiao shipping to Canada expensive? +
Air: Cainiao's air shipping is fast (3–5 business days), but relatively expensive. For example, the first 1kg is ¥90, and each 0.5kg additional is ¥25. For a 5kg parcel, total is roughly ¥290.
Sea: Sea shipping is more cost-effective, though slower. Usually 15+ days. Ideal for non-urgent shipments.
